If you want to allow your employees to log in to your Belbo calendar on a private mobile device, for example, they can receive their own logins. This type of login can be restricted in various ways. In everyday work, the Team Login continues to be used on the company computer.

Additional security with 2FA
Especially for logins used on private mobile devices, it is recommended to additionally activate two-factor authentication (2FA). This keeps the login protected even if the password falls into the wrong hands.
Permissions in the rights overview
We recommend giving private logins only the "login only" permission. Senior employees or admins are of course exempt from this. Logins with only this permission can view and create appointments, but cannot log into time tracking or view the cash register function.

Permissions in the employee profile
In addition to permissions, further restrictions or authorizations can also be stored in the person's profile under "Access restrictions", after the login has been created.

Restrict appointment view
If you want a login to not be able to scroll back in the past, but only see today and the future, activate this restriction in the team member's profile.
Hide customer data
If you don't want a login to have access to customer data, but only to see upcoming appointments, you can activate "Hide customer data and block access to customer files". Block entering & editing appointments
If customer names are allowed to be seen, but appointments should not be edited or created, you can activate this permission.
Enable access to own dashboard
An employee's dashboard displays numerous data such as sales, time tracking including overtime or minus hours, reports and more. If employees should have access to parts of this data, you can activate the "Own dashboard may be viewed" option.

Restrict employee's view of specific employees
If you want a login to only see certain calendar columns (usually their own), you can activate this option. Important: Then select the permitted calendar column(s):

Access to Belbo from your mobile phone
Your employees can download the free Belbo App (iOS, Android) to their phone or log into the calendar via the website https://belbo.com/login (All users outside Switzerland) or https://belbo.ch/login (Swiss users).
